“A place to connect with your faith awaits” they say about Iglesia Santa María Virgen. Here at the corner of Carrera 80 and Diagonal 31I stands Iglesia Santa María Virgen. It is a beacon of spirituality in the El Recreo neighborhood.

Iglesia Santa María Virgen is known as Parroquia Asunción Santa María Virgen El Recreo. It is more than just a building. It is a vibrant community. Locals have rated this church highly. It has an average score of 4.7 out of 5 from 92 reviews. This shows how satisfied visitors are.

You will notice the church is accessible. Iglesia Santa María Virgen provides ease for everyone. The entrance and parking are designed for wheelchairs. This inclusive approach creates a welcoming environment.

Looking for guidance? Seeking peace? The Iglesia Santa María Virgen offers both. The church’s Facebook page offers a glimpse into its community. You can find it at the provided link. The page shows an active and engaged congregation.

Here are the service times. Weekday evenings offer services at 6 PM. Thursdays extend the evening service to 8 PM. Saturday mornings start early at 7 AM. There is also a Saturday evening service at 6 PM. Sunday offers multiple services. You can attend at 8 AM 10 AM or 5:30 PM.
